analphabetic

an·al·pha·bet·ic [ a nàlfə béttik ]


adjective 
Definition:
 
1. not alphabetical: not in alphabetical order

2. illiterate: not knowing how to read or write



noun  (plural an·al·pha·bet·ics)
Definition:
 
illiterate person: somebody who cannot read or write

[Late 19th century. < Greek analphabētos "not knowing the alphabet" < alphabētos "alphabet"]
